Salt Composition

Phenylephrine (5mg/5ml) + Chlorpheniramine Maleate (2mg/5ml) + Dextromethorphan Hydrobromide (10mg/5ml)

Overview Ridkof Syrup

RespirAid Syrup effectively manages common cold and cough symptoms. It offers rapid relief from runny nose, nasal congestion, sneezing, watery eyes, and cough. RespirAid Syrup's dosage and duration are determined by your physician, taken with or without food. Treatment should continue as directed; premature cessation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Inform your doctor about all other medications you're using, as interactions are possible. Potential side effects include headache, drowsiness, blurred vision, vomiting, diarrhea, dry mouth, and nausea; most are transient. Report any concerning side effects immediately. Drowsiness may occur; avoid driving or tasks requiring alertness until the effects are known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. Self-medication and recommending this syrup to others are strongly discouraged. Adequate hydration is recommended. Disclose pregnancy, pregnancy planning, breastfeeding, kidney, or liver conditions to your doctor prior to use to ensure appropriate dosage.

How Ridkof Syrup works:

Tri-Med Syrup combines phenylephrine, chlorpheniramine maleate, and dextromethorphan hydrobromide to address cold and allergy symptoms. Phenylephrine constricts nasal blood vessels, relieving congestion. Chlorpheniramine maleate counteracts allergic responses such as rhinorrhea, lacrimation, and sneezing. Dextromethorphan hydrobromide acts as a cough suppressant by dampening the brain's cough reflex.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CAUTION

Use caution when combining Ridkof Syrup and alcohol. Seek medical advice before doing so.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The safety of Ridkof Syrup during pregnancy is uncertain.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the risks and benefits prior to prescribing it.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using Ridkof Syrup while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Preliminary research in humans ind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Ridkof Syrup.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Ridkof Syrup in individuals with kidney impairment appears to pose minimal risk.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, but phys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verUNSAFE

Patients with liver disorders should likely refrain from using Ridkof Syrup due to potential safety concerns. A physician's cons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Ridkof Syrup :

Should you forget a dose of Ridkof Syrup,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Ridkof Syrup

Ridkof Syrup may cause drowsiness or sleepiness, potentially affecting your ability to perform daily tasks. Until you understand its effects, refrain from driving, operating machinery, working at heights, or engaging in hazardous activities. Report any drowsiness experienced while using this medication to your doctor.
Increasing your dosage beyond the recommended amount won't necessarily improve results; it could instead lead to severe side effects and toxicity. If your symptoms worsen despite taking the prescribed dose, consult your doctor for further assessment.
Breastfeeding is not recommended while taking Ridkof Syrup. The syrup contains Chlorpheniramine, an antihistamine that can transfer to breast milk and potentially harm your baby. If prescribed Ridkof Syrup, be sure to tell your doctor you are breastfeeding.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container as directed on the label. Discard any unused medication; ke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
